Google Wallet Unveils 'Everything Else' Feature for Digital Passes with AI-Powered Enhancements
August 14, 2024Google Wallet has launched a new feature called 'Everything Else' for Android, enabling users to create digital passes from photos of various documents, including IDs, tickets, and passes.
This rollout follows the announcement made at the Google I/O developer conference in May 2024, where several AI-driven features were introduced.
The 'Everything Else' option replaces the previous 'Photo' feature, allowing users to scan physical cards with their phone's camera and generate digital versions.
AI technology is utilized to identify the type of pass being added and suggest appropriate content for the digital version, enhancing user experience.
Google Wallet will automatically assign a category to the pass, but users can change it; categories include business cards, driver's licenses, and health insurance.
Sensitive information, such as health and government ID details, will be classified as private and will not sync across devices without authentication.
Once finalized, the digital pass will be displayed below users' credit and debit cards in the app, streamlining access to important documents.
Google has provided instructions for using this feature and has begun rolling it out to users in the United States this month.
Currently, the 'Everything Else' feature is only available to users in the United States, with plans for broader availability in the future.
Some users have reported availability of the feature on devices like the Galaxy Note 20, while others, such as the Pixel 6, may not have it yet.
While the update enhances the digital wallet experience, users are cautioned not to rely solely on digital versions in critical situations.
Items added to Google Wallet can be shared with other Google Wallets, but sensitive information will remain private, ensuring user security.
